Rick Culbertson, in association with Lynn Marks and Paradox Entertainment, today announced the critically acclaimed production of Divorce! The Musical will create two special reading presentations to benefit the Courage Campaign. These performances will take place at the Hudson Mainstage Theatre in Los Angeles and showcase a lesbian couple on Monday, May 11 and a gay couple on Tuesday, May 12. 100% of the proceeds will go toward the Courage Campaign's efforts to restore marriage equality.

"Divorce! The Musical encourages the audience to laugh at marriage and its ugly side - divorce. But it also highlights the subtle nuances of a relationship - the aspects of which are universal and applicable to both heterosexual and homosexual relationships," said show creator Erin Kamler. "Though the play tackles the fleeting world of relationships in a lighter vein, the issue of marriage equality that it supports is no laughing matter. The cast and the crew strongly believe in marriage equality for everyone and passionately support the Courage Campaign in their quest to restore marriage equality. I hope our two reading presentations focusing on the gay and lesbian aspects of divorce will bring us one step closer to marriage equality in California."

With music, book and lyrics by Erin Kamler, and directed by multi-award winning director, Rick Sparks, Divorce! The Musical is a hilarious and poignant examination of the institution of marriage; and has been successfully playing to full houses since opening on Valentines day 2009. In its current form Divorce! The Musical is the story of a heterosexual relationship that is embroiled in denial, deception and raw outrage as it ends in a divorce after four years. The script is being specially rewritten for the two benefit reading presentations and will highlight the trials and tribulations that gay and lesbian couples potentially experience in relationships.

"Sometimes the best way to promote understanding is through the performing arts. Divorce! The Musical does just that by presenting the ironies present in the institution of marriage," added Rick Jacobs, the Courage Campaign's Founder and Chair commenting on this new approach to garner support for the campaign. "Our thanks to the company of Divorce! The Musical for their support of our efforts to restore marriage equality in California."

The Courage Campaign, an online organizing network working towards progressive change, is currently canvassing to help build grassroots support to restore marriage equality to California. Since the passage of Prop 8 in November the Courage Campaign has worked tirelessly to accomplish this mission through its Equality Program and its series of Camp Courage trainings. With Iowa's repeal of its ban on same-sex marriage and Vermont's recent move to legalize same-sex marriage, momentum for marriage equality nationwide continues to grow. Divorce! The Musical is its first-ever attempt to build awareness and sponsorship for a cause through the performing arts.
